Maintenance Manager

Location: North of Oklahoma City, OK

Comp: $150,000 to $180,000 + bonus

Benefits include medical, dental, vision, 401(k)

  • Relocation benefits available for a qualified candidate

We are conducting a search for a Maintenance Manager to lead all maintenance and reliability functions for a high-volume manufacturing facility. This role is responsible for overseeing equipment performance, facility maintenance, regulatory compliance, and the implementation of continuous improvement initiatives. The Maintenance Manager will guide a cross-functional maintenance team, manage capital projects, and ensure safe, efficient, and reliable plant operations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Oversee daily maintenance activities for plant equipment, utilities, facilities, and production systems.
  • Lead maintenance planning, scheduling, and preventive/predictive maintenance programs to maximize equipment uptime.
  • Support facility improvements, line layout changes, and plant expansion or modification projects.
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A and all applicable safety and regulatory standards.
  • Provide maintenance and engineering teams with the tools, training, and resources needed to support long-term reliability.
  • Develop and manage capital and expense budgets; lead execution of CapEx projects.
  • Partner with contractors, vendors, and service providers to ensure efficient project and maintenance support.
  • Troubleshoot operational issues and collaborate closely with plant leadership to drive timely solutions.
  • Lead, mentor, and develop maintenance staff; foster a collaborative, safety-focused work culture.

Qualifications

Skills & Competencies

  • Strong mechanical aptitude with understanding of mechanical, electrical, and industrial systems.
  • Proven ability to manage competing priorities in a fast-paced production environment.
  • Strong project management and organizational skills.
  • Demonstrated analytical and troubleshooting abilities.
  • Effective communicator with strong interpersonal and leadership capabilities.
  • Working knowledge of refrigeration, utilities, or similar systems (preferred but not required).
  • Proficiency with maintenance-related software and tools (e.g., Excel, CMMS, Word, CAD basics, PLC fundamentals).

Education & Experience

  • Associate degree in a mechanical, electrical, or technical field—or equivalent hands-on experience.
  • Minimum 5 years of maintenance leadership experience within a manufacturing environment.

Licenses & Certifications

  • Mechanical contractor or technical certifications are a plus; may be required depending on facility needs.

Physical Demands / Work Environment

  • Regular standing, walking, bending, and lifting up to 40 lbs.
  • Work performed in varied manufacturing environments requiring PPE (e.g., safety glasses, hearing protection).
  • May involve exposure to a range of temperatures depending on production areas.
  • Noisy environment at times; ear protection required.

Candidate Profile

Top Requirements

  • 5+ years of relevant manufacturing maintenance experience
  • Stable work history with consistent tenure in each role is required
  • Strong leadership presence and a proactive, solutions-focused mindset

Nice to Have

  • Technical certifications (e.g., CE, refrigeration, electrical)
  • Experience in environments with strict sanitation or chemical-cleaning protocols
